a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orGeir Storli <geirst@verizonmedia.com>2019-05-28 10:59:40 +0200
committerGitHub <noreply@github.com>2019-05-28 10:59:40 +0200
commitd74337500a4b1d52879a4c36f431c132ec39c16b (patch)
tree842a22e1488cff7ad7e6f34db4fe61459450196d
parentafd34463e0e857f5bf52fd60bdd2fcaa4e01b77a (diff)
parent6176ae28777fc6d2894485e38cc0e48cf7caf986 (diff)
Merge pull request #9566 from vespa-engine/toregge/specify-what-to-unpack-for-bm25-feature
Trim down what to unpack for bm25 feature.
-rw-r--r--searchlib/src/vespa/searchlib/features/bm25_feature.cpp3
1 files changed, 2 insertions, 1 deletions
diff --git a/searchlib/src/vespa/searchlib/features/bm25_feature.cpp b/searchlib/src/vespa/searchlib/features/bm25_feature.cpp
index 58c45afba9c..a9430db09c3 100644
--- a/searchlib/src/vespa/searchlib/features/bm25_feature.cpp
+++ b/searchlib/src/vespa/searchlib/features/bm25_feature.cpp
@@ -12,6 +12,7 @@ using fef::FeatureExecutor;
using fef::FieldInfo;
using fef::ITermData;
using fef::ITermFieldData;
+using fef::MatchDataDetails;
Bm25Executor::Bm25Executor(const fef::FieldInfo& field,
const fef::IQueryEnvironment& env)
@@ -29,7 +30,7 @@ Bm25Executor::Bm25Executor(const fef::FieldInfo& field,
const ITermFieldData& term_field = term->field(j);
if (field.id() == term_field.getFieldId()) {
// TODO: Add proper calculation of IDF
- _terms.emplace_back(term_field.getHandle(), 1.0);
+ _terms.emplace_back(term_field.getHandle(MatchDataDetails::Cheap), 1.0);
}
}
}